The number of civil servants has increased in Southern Cyprus
The number of civil servants in Southern Cyprus has risen to 55,305 people.
According to data published yesterday by the Greek Cypriot Statistical Service, the number of civil servants increased by 0.9 percent in May this year compared to May last year.
The number of public sector employees grew by 479 people, with 0.1 percent of this increase attributed to civil servants and 3.3 percent to teachers. It was also reported that the number of civil servants working in security forces decreased by 0.8 percent.
